Where is the Big Ben volcano located?

Big Ben volcano is located on Heard Island, which lies 4100 km south-west of Perth, Western Australia.

What is the Big Ben volcano?

A volcano that erupted in 2007 on an Australian island ( Heard Island) which is 4,100 km south-west of the mainland and 1,500 km north of Antarctica.

How did the Big Ben Volcano on heard island form?

The Big Ben volcano on Heard Island was formed by repeated eruptions and the resulting lava flows. Over time the lava built up until it resulted in this huge volcanic mountain located in the Indian Ocean.
